Call cc.central_signal — Unified signal ingestion endpoint that normalizes symbols from any exchange format (Binance, Bybit, TradingView) to executable format and routes to execution. Purpose: Unified signal ingestion endpoint that normalizes symbols from any exchange format (Binance, Bybit, TradingView) to executable format and routes to execution. Behavior: DESTRUCTIVE. Normalizes the signal and routes toward trade execution for the authenticated account. Can open/close positions. Auth: X-Api-Key required (and linked exchange credentials for execution actions). Cost: $0.01 USDC per successful call (x402 Base USDC pay-per-use or prepaid X-Api-Key balance). Linked Connect keys are free. This is billing, not a side effect. Rate limit: 30/min (per API key). Tier: premium. Returns: Signal confirmation with execution status, order ID, fill price, and routing metadata. Guidelines: Use for research / signal context. Pair with cc.agent_strategy (paper) before any live order. Do not invent fills from this data alone. Tags: signals, execution, routing, tradingview, webhook, automation.

Disambiguation2/5

Multiple tools have overlapping or unclear boundaries. The AI chat tools cc.squirrel_chat, cc.squirrel_chat_v2, and cc.openclaw_chat all provide conversational trading assistance with near-identical descriptions, while cc.central_signal and cc.external_signal both normalize signals for execution. Additionally, cc.asset_scanner, cc.auto_fetch_market_data, cc.data_tools, and cc.ma_fetch all supply technical indicator data with significant overlap.

Naming Consistency4/5

All tools share the 'cc.' prefix and use snake_case consistently, which creates a uniform feel. However, naming style mixes nouns (cc.asset_scanner, cc.data_tools) with verbs (cc.auto_fetch, cc.list_catalog) and compound forms (cc.strategy_backtest, cc.trade_builder), so it is not a strict verb_noun pattern. Minor deviations keep it from a 5.

Tool Count2/5

With 33 tools, the server is well beyond the typical well-scoped range of 3-15 and even above the 'heavy' 16-25 range. While the trading intelligence domain can be broad, this count feels overstuffed rather than curated, especially given the many overlapping data and AI tools.

Completeness3/5

The core trading workflow is covered: market data, technical analysis, signals, strategy backtesting, paper trading, and live execution all have tools. However, there is no dedicated account management tool (e.g., get_balance, list_positions) and no explicit delete_strategy, with these operations buried inside cc.agent_strategy's action parameter. Notable gaps remain for a complete lifecycle.
